WebEarthworm : Nervous System. The brain is formed of the supra pharyngeal ganglia. It is a bilobed mass of nervous tissue situated on the dorsal wall of the pharynx in 3rd seg … WebNervous System of Earthworm: The nervous system consists of the nerve ring and a ventral nerve cord. The nerve ring is formed of paired cerebral or supra-pharyngeal ganglia, circumpharyngeal or peripharyngeal connectives and sub-pharyngeal ganglia. A pair of closely united pear-shaped cerebral ganglia forms the so called brain.
